ABOUT
Nicholas is from Valparaiso, Indiana and lives in Bloomington, Indiana with his wife and two daughters. He is an active member in the Bloomington Community, serving on non-profit Boards and volunteering with local organizations.

RISK MANAMGENET EXPERIENCE
Nicholas has been a Certified Risk Manager since 2022 and was certified as an Environmental Strategist in 2023. He has worked on managing risk for areas including residential and commercial property, corporate auto liability, global cargo, aviation (aircraft and forward base of operations), workers compensation, errors and omissions (professional liability), and pollution liability.
